10 Episodes 2018 - 2018
Episode 1
Mick Philpott: An examination of Mick Philpott, the notorious Derby father of 17 who murdered six children, five of them his own, when he set his own home on fire.

Episode 2
Mark Bridger: In 2012, April Jones disappeared from outside her home in Wales, never to be seen again. Her abductor, and murderer, was found to be Mark Bridger.

Episode 3
Stephen Port murdered at least four men using social networks to find his victims - for which he earned himself the nickname "The Grindr Killer"

Episode 4
Raoul Moat: What drove Raoul Moat to shoot his ex-girlfriend, her new lover and a policeman, leading to the largest manhunt in modern British history?

Episode 5
Roy Whiting: A profile of child killer Roy Whiting, the convicted sex offender who abducted and murdered eight-year-old Sarah Payne.

Episode 6
John Duffy and David Mulcahy - The Railway Killers: A profile of the two murderers who terrorised Britain in the 1980's with a string of attacks near railway stations.
Episode 7
Tracie Andrews: A profile of the former aspiring model who stabbed her fiance 42 times, before blaming the attack on a fictional road rage assailant.

Episode 8
Steven Grieveson - The Sunderland Strangler: Known as the "Sunderland Strangler", Steven Grieveson murdered four teenage boys before his capture. But what was his motive?

Episode 9
The case of the cannibal cop killer, Stefano Brizzi, who murdered and consumed part of a police officer he met through a dating app.

Episode 10
Profiling the Italian killer, jailed for murdering and mutilating his Bournemouth neighbour, Heather Barnett, in 2002.
